What is national register of historic?
The National Register of Historic Places is the official list of the Nation's historic places worthy of preservation.
Who is required to file national register of historic?
Property owners, organizations, or individuals interested in nominating a property for inclusion on the National Register of Historic Places are required to file.
How to fill out national register of historic?
To fill out the National Register of Historic Places nomination form, you need to provide detailed information about the property's history, significance, and architectural features.
What is the purpose of national register of historic?
The purpose of the National Register of Historic Places is to identify, evaluate, and protect properties that represent the Nation's diverse cultural heritage.
What information must be reported on national register of historic?
The information required for the National Register of Historic Places nomination includes historical background, architectural description, photographs, and significance of the property.
